]> git.mxchange.org Git - friendica.git/blobdiff - src/Core/PConfig.php
Merge pull request #5438 from MrPetovan/task/5410-remove-dbm-class
[friendica.git] / src / Core / PConfig.php
index 3b01bceeaf8a916bcd86584b454f98f489f78ada..e8b5c6ca5af2be985e99b2be1a63960015d07fcc 100644 (file)
@@ -29,7 +29,7 @@ class PConfig extends BaseObject
        public static function init($uid)
        {
                // Database isn't ready or populated yet
-               if (self::getApp()->mode === \Friendica\App::MODE_INSTALL) {
+               if (!(self::getApp()->mode & \Friendica\App::MODE_DBCONFIGAVAILABLE)) {
                        return;
                }
 
@@ -54,7 +54,7 @@ class PConfig extends BaseObject
        public static function load($uid, $family)
        {
                // Database isn't ready or populated yet
-               if (self::getApp()->mode === \Friendica\App::MODE_INSTALL) {
+               if (!(self::getApp()->mode & \Friendica\App::MODE_DBCONFIGAVAILABLE)) {
                        return;
                }
 
@@ -83,7 +83,7 @@ class PConfig extends BaseObject
        public static function get($uid, $family, $key, $default_value = null, $refresh = false)
        {
                // Database isn't ready or populated yet
-               if (self::getApp()->mode === \Friendica\App::MODE_INSTALL) {
+               if (!(self::getApp()->mode & \Friendica\App::MODE_DBCONFIGAVAILABLE)) {
                        return;
                }
 
@@ -107,12 +107,12 @@ class PConfig extends BaseObject
         * @param string $key    The configuration key to set
         * @param string $value  The value to store
         *
-        * @return mixed Stored $value or false
+        * @return bool Operation success
         */
        public static function set($uid, $family, $key, $value)
        {
                // Database isn't ready or populated yet
-               if (self::getApp()->mode === \Friendica\App::MODE_INSTALL) {
+               if (!(self::getApp()->mode & \Friendica\App::MODE_DBCONFIGAVAILABLE)) {
                        return false;
                }
 
@@ -138,7 +138,7 @@ class PConfig extends BaseObject
        public static function delete($uid, $family, $key)
        {
                // Database isn't ready or populated yet
-               if (self::getApp()->mode === \Friendica\App::MODE_INSTALL) {
+               if (!(self::getApp()->mode & \Friendica\App::MODE_DBCONFIGAVAILABLE)) {
                        return false;
                }